Output e8f1891361e1b1ccac86bccfd78dff29e10aaab9d0179da16955eec21d929f57:0

value
668521
script pubkey
OP_0 OP_PUSHBYTES_20 56873a8a4ad6a83ac32010fabea5cef6b5f248d9
address
bc1q26rn4zj2665r4seqzratafww766lyjxenjk3u3
transaction
e8f1891361e1b1ccac86bccfd78dff29e10aaab9d0179da16955eec21d929f57
spent
true